Why wholesale network operations break before the business does
Wholesale network operations are structurally complex. Demand signals come from sales teams, customer contracts, eCommerce channels, service commitments and project-based orders. Supply signals come from vendors, manufacturing partners, inbound logistics providers and internal replenishment rules. Finance needs margin accuracy, landed cost visibility, receivables discipline and intercompany controls. Operations needs warehouse productivity, stock accuracy, service-level performance and exception management. Legacy ERP environments struggle because they were often configured for a simpler business model and then stretched through customizations that no longer reflect current operating realities.
The result is a familiar pattern: planners cannot trust available-to-promise data, procurement teams overbuy to protect service levels, warehouse teams work around system limitations, finance closes slowly because operational data is inconsistent, and leadership lacks a unified view of profitability by customer, product, region or channel. In network-centric wholesale businesses, scalability fails first in coordination, not capacity.
The operational bottlenecks executives should diagnose first
- Inventory visibility gaps across warehouses, transit stock, consignment locations and intercompany transfers
- Procurement workflows that rely on email approvals, spreadsheet planning or disconnected supplier communications
- Order orchestration issues caused by partial stock, substitute items, drop-ship scenarios and customer-specific fulfillment rules
- Margin leakage from poor landed cost allocation, rebate complexity, pricing exceptions and manual credit handling
- Integration fragility between ERP, CRM, eCommerce, shipping, EDI, BI and finance systems
- Governance weaknesses around master data, role-based access, auditability and change control

A practical roadmap for scalable network operations
A successful roadmap usually starts with process simplification before platform expansion. Many wholesale businesses try to replicate every legacy exception in the new ERP and then wonder why modernization becomes expensive and slow. A better sequence is to define the future-state process architecture, identify the few differentiators that truly matter commercially, and standardize the rest. This is especially important in multi-company environments where local practices often conflict with enterprise controls.
Phase one should focus on core transaction integrity: item master governance, customer and supplier data quality, chart of accounts alignment, warehouse structures, replenishment policies, pricing logic and approval matrices. Phase two should address workflow automation, integration modernization and management reporting. Phase three can extend into AI-assisted operations, predictive exception handling, advanced planning and broader ecosystem integration. This sequencing reduces risk because it stabilizes the data and process foundation before introducing more automation.
Decision framework: standardize, differentiate or integrate
Executives should classify each process into one of three categories. Standardize processes that do not create market advantage, such as routine approvals, basic accounting controls and common warehouse transactions. Differentiate processes that directly support customer value, such as contract-specific fulfillment, service bundles, channel pricing or project-linked delivery models. Integrate processes that must remain connected to external systems, such as EDI, carrier platforms, tax engines, customer portals or specialized manufacturing systems. This framework prevents over-customization while preserving strategic flexibility.
Business process optimization opportunities that create measurable ROI
In wholesale operations, ROI often comes from fewer exceptions rather than dramatic labor elimination. Better replenishment logic reduces emergency purchasing and excess stock. Improved order promising reduces split shipments and customer escalations. Stronger procurement controls improve supplier performance and reduce invoice disputes. Integrated finance shortens close cycles and improves margin analysis. Workflow automation reduces approval delays and strengthens accountability. These gains compound because they improve both service quality and working capital efficiency.
Consider a distributor operating three legal entities and six warehouses across two regions. Sales teams promise delivery based on local stock views, procurement buys against outdated spreadsheets, and finance reconciles intercompany transfers manually. Modernizing onto a unified ERP model with multi-company management, multi-warehouse inventory rules, automated replenishment and integrated accounting can materially improve stock accuracy, transfer discipline and profitability visibility. The value is not just lower administrative effort. It is the ability to scale new locations, suppliers and channels without recreating operational chaos.
KPIs that matter more than generic ERP success metrics
| Domain | Executive KPI | Why it matters |
|---|---|---|
| Customer service | Order fill rate and on-time-in-full | Measures whether network operations can meet commitments at scale |
| Inventory | Inventory accuracy, turns and stockout frequency | Shows whether working capital and service levels are balanced |
| Procurement | Supplier lead-time adherence and purchase price variance | Indicates sourcing reliability and cost control |
| Warehouse operations | Pick accuracy, transfer cycle time and receiving throughput | Reflects execution quality across the physical network |
| Finance | Gross margin by channel, days sales outstanding and close cycle time | Connects operational performance to financial outcomes |
| Transformation | User adoption, exception volume and automation rate | Reveals whether modernization is changing behavior, not just systems |

Common implementation mistakes in wholesale modernization
- Treating ERP modernization as a technical migration instead of an operating model redesign
- Carrying forward poor master data and inconsistent item, supplier or customer structures
- Over-customizing workflows before standard processes are stabilized
- Ignoring warehouse process reality, including receiving, putaway, cycle counts, returns and transfer exceptions
- Underestimating intercompany accounting, tax, approval governance and compliance requirements
- Launching dashboards before agreeing on KPI definitions, ownership and data stewardship
- Failing to plan change management for branch managers, planners, buyers, warehouse leads and finance controllers
The most expensive mistake is usually governance neglect. Wholesale businesses often have strong operators but weak process ownership across functions. Without clear decision rights, every exception becomes a customization request, every report becomes a debate and every rollout issue becomes an IT problem. Executive sponsorship must therefore include process governance, not just budget approval.
Risk mitigation, compliance and change management in real operating environments
Risk mitigation in wholesale ERP modernization should focus on continuity of fulfillment, financial integrity and data trust. A phased rollout by company, warehouse or process domain is often safer than a broad cutover, particularly where inventory accuracy is uneven. Parallel validation of pricing, tax, stock valuation, receivables and supplier balances is essential. Compliance requirements vary by geography and industry segment, but governance should consistently address segregation of duties, approval traceability, document retention, audit readiness and access control.
Change management should be role-specific. Warehouse supervisors need confidence in transaction design and exception handling. Buyers need clarity on replenishment logic and approval thresholds. Sales leaders need trust in pricing, availability and customer commitments. Finance leaders need confidence that operational transactions post correctly and support timely close. Training should therefore be scenario-based, using realistic workflows such as backorders, returns, intercompany transfers, supplier delays, damaged goods and customer credit holds.
Future trends shaping wholesale network operations
The next phase of wholesale ERP modernization will be defined by decision support rather than transaction digitization alone. AI-assisted operations will increasingly help identify replenishment risks, detect margin anomalies, prioritize exceptions and improve service response. Business intelligence will move closer to operational workflows so managers can act within the process rather than after the fact. Customer lifecycle management will become more integrated with fulfillment and finance, enabling better account profitability analysis and service differentiation.
At the same time, enterprise integration will become more strategic. Wholesale networks are expanding through marketplaces, partner ecosystems, field service models and hybrid manufacturing-distribution operations. ERP platforms must therefore support APIs, event-driven data exchange and modular process extension without sacrificing governance. Enterprises that modernize with this in mind will be better prepared for acquisitions, regional expansion, new service lines and partner-led operating models.
